  • Statistics for Taylor, Missouri

  • The population of Taylor is 662. 348 are Males and 314 are Females.

    The Total Area covered by Taylor, Missouri is 42.01 Sq. Miles.
    The population density in Taylor, MO. is 16.01 persons/sq. mile.
    The Taylor elevation is 641 Ft.

    Enrollment and Education for Taylor:
    133 students are enrolled in school in Taylor, Missouri (over 3 years of age).
    Of those who are enrolled in Taylor:
    11 students are attending Nursery School in Taylor.
    17 students are enrolled in Kindergarten.
    80 students in Taylor are enrolled in Primary School
    17 students attend High School in Taylor.
    8 students attend College in Taylor.
    Taylor Employment Info:
    353 people are employed in Taylor.
    0 people are unemployed in Taylor, Missouri.

In addition there are programs in Taylor which don't actually deliver any rehab at all but make use of healthcare drugs to help clients get off of drugs. Methadone facilities for example have been in existence for a very long time, first used with the intention to help heroin addicts stop drug seeking habits and prevent effects of heroin use including criminal behavior and its penalties in addition to health effects. These types of facilities which now include buprenorphine and several other drugs are called opioid maintenance therapy, and this treatment now addresses issues associated with prescription pain killer abuse because these medicines are now abused at similar rates to heroin these days. The reason some people may turn to such a center as being a solution is because they feel they can't handle the urges and withdrawal symptoms that they will ultimately suffer from after they stop using all at once. So instead, the seemingly easy way out is by using methadone or a similar medication which eliminates cravings and withdrawal symptoms, but itself is a regiment which itself must be maintained to prevent craving and withdrawal. So this too isn't an extremely ideal circumstance for someone who wished to completely do away with drugs from their life that they depend on for either physical or psychological satisfaction.
